Cultural Crossroads : The Lasting Effect of Colonialism on Indigenous Peoples
Colonization has left an enduring and multifaceted scar on indigenous populations across the globe. The forceful imposition of European values often erased traditional ways of life, languages, and cultural heritages. This systematic oppression has had a profound impact on the social, economic, and political well-being of indigenous communities.
- , For instance, the introduction of new diseases ravaged indigenous populations who lacked immunity.
- Land appropriation has profoundly undermined their ability to sustain themselves through traditional practices
- The legacy of colonialism continues to manifest in contemporary challenges faced by indigenous peoples.
It is essential that we acknowledge the enduring effects of colonialism and work towards healing. This includes promoting indigenous voices, upholding their rights, and partnering to create a more just future for all.
